Performance Management Design

Performance management often becomes either too process-heavy or too subjective. Employees are not always clear on what matters most. Managers struggle to set meaningful goals. Reviews become backward-looking. Performance conversations focus more on ratings than improvement.

Meeraq helps organizations design performance management systems that are practical, business-linked, and usable by managers.

Depending on the context, this may include KRAs, KPIs, OKRs, goal-setting principles, review rhythms, feedback mechanisms, manager enablement, and performance conversation design.

The aim is not to create a complicated PMS. The aim is to help people know what they are accountable for, how progress will be reviewed, and how performance conversations will improve.

Succession Planning & Talent Reviews

Many organizations discuss succession only when a role becomes vacant. By then, the risk is already visible.

Succession planning helps organizations build a clearer view of critical roles, successor readiness, leadership bench strength, and development priorities. Talent reviews create a structured way for leaders to discuss people beyond performance numbers.

This is especially useful when leadership continuity is important, when the organization is scaling, or when too much knowledge and decision-making sits with a few individuals.

For investor-led companies, this can also help identify key person dependency and management depth risks.

HiPo Identification & Development

High potential should not simply mean “high performer who is liked by leaders.”

A strong HiPo process helps organizations look at performance, potential, learning agility, aspiration, leadership behaviours, role readiness, and future-fit. It also helps reduce subjectivity in who gets selected for accelerated development.

Meeraq helps organizations identify high-potential talent and design development journeys that prepare them for larger responsibilities.

This may include assessment, talent conversations, development centres, leadership journeys, coaching, action learning, business projects, and progress reviews.

Capability Academies

Training calendars are useful, but they do not always build capability in a structured way.

Capability academies help organizations build skills and behaviours through role-based learning paths, practice, application, manager reinforcement, and progress tracking.

These academies can be built for managers, sales teams, leadership pipelines, functional roles, customer-facing teams, or specific business priorities.

For large enterprises, academies help create consistency across scale. For growth-stage companies, they help build capability before complexity slows growth. For PE-backed companies, they can support rapid capability building after investment.
